Description of the Change
Added support for prebuilt binaries for 32 bit ARM architecture. This is useful when compiling Electron apps that are supposed to also work on Raspberry Pi (most userlands are 32 bit there).
Alternate Designs
Not having a prebuilt binary means that every app needs to be compiled on a separate machine, which is painful.
